Job Summary

Training and BCC Officer will have the responsibility to work under the supervision of Training and BCC Manager for the development and the management of Malaria control and Prevention program in KPK, Tribal Districts Merge Areas (FATA and FR’s).

Key Responsibilities:

  • Main responsibility is to assist the manager in building consensus with the local authorities (PR, district authorities and focal persons)
  • Participate in and facilitate the monthly/quarterly coordination/ review meetings at district/agency level.
  • Compile and analyze the information of all evaluations done and provide feedback to the malaria management team.
  • Provide strategic leadership for developing organizational BCC strategy.
  • Support partners in developing customized tools, messages and action plan for implementing BCC strategy.
  • Assist Training and BCC Manager in providing technical guidance and oversight in designing relevant IEC material including posters, flyers, radio programs and video documentation.
  • Work under the supervision of Training and BCC Manager for guidance on effective use of IEC materials.
  • Check the documents of lady health workers & community based organizations BCC activities.
  • Develop quarterly & monthly BCC plan & get approval from PR as well as National Program.
  • Monitor Advocacy/BCC events at district and Field level.
  • Represent organization at different forums.
  • Prepare Data base/reports and share with all stakeholders including Managers and Field staff.
  • Facilitate & represent organization during third party evaluation such as Local Funding Agent, Onsite data verification & data quality audit.

Experience / Skills

Essential:

  • Minimum 1-2 years of working experience in BCC, Social Mobilization in Humanitarian Organization (NGO/INGO) Sector.
  • At least Graduate in Social Work or equivalent.
  • Strong Communication Skills (Good Report Writing, Inter Personal Skills).
  • Computer literate with full command on Word, Excel.

Desirable:

  • With 2 years of work experience in Health Sector.
  • Should be able to travel & work in Tribal District Merged areas (FATA).
  • Good knowledge of English and excellent command of local languages, particularly Pashto.
  • Experience in Training Needs Assessments and Needs-based Participatory Training.
